Descriptive Gazetteer Entry for LINGARDS, or LINGARTHS

LINGARDS, or LINGARTHS, a township in Almondbury parish, W. R. Yorkshire; 3½ miles S of Huddersfield. Acres, 500. Pop., 783. Houses, 149. The township forms part of Slaithwaite chapelry, and partakes in the interests of Slaithwaite village and township.


(John Marius Wilson, Imperial Gazetteer of England and Wales (1870-72))
